Index: head/net/freenet6/Makefile =================================================================== --- head/net/freenet6/Makefile (revision 443691) +++ head/net/freenet6/Makefile (revision 443692) @@ -1,34 +1,34 @@ # Created by: Edwin Groothuis # $FreeBSD$ PORTNAME= freenet6 DISTVERSION= 6_0_1 -PORTREVISION= 1 +PORTREVISION= 2 CATEGORIES= net ipv6 MASTER_SITES= http://go6.net/4105/file.asp?file_id=166& DISTNAME= tspc-${PORTVERSION}-src MAINTAINER= ports@FreeBSD.org COMMENT= Hexago Freenet6 Tunnel Setup Protocol Client - Free IPv6 tunnel LICENSE= BSD3CLAUSE LICENSE_FILE= ${WRKSRC}/../CLIENT-LICENSE.TXT USES= gmake ssl tar:tgz MAKE_ARGS= target=freebsd CC="${CC}" CXX="${CXX}" \ installdir="${STAGEDIR}${PREFIX}" ETCDIR="${ETCDIR}" WRKSRC= ${WRKDIR}/gw6c-${DISTVERSION}/tspc-advanced USE_RC_SUBR= freenet6 SUB_FILES= pkg-message MAKE_JOBS_UNSAFE=yes post-fetch: @if [ ! -f ${DISTDIR}/${DISTNAME}${EXTRACT_SUFX} ]; then \ ${MV} ${DISTDIR}/file.asp*file_id*166* \ ${DISTDIR}/${DISTNAME}${EXTRACT_SUFX}; \ fi .include Index: head/net/freenet6/files/freenet6.in =================================================================== --- head/net/freenet6/files/freenet6.in (revision 443691) +++ head/net/freenet6/files/freenet6.in (revision 443692) @@ -1,36 +1,37 @@ #!/bin/sh # # $FreeBSD$ # # # PROVIDE: freenet6 # REQUIRE: NETWORKING netif named # BEFORE: ip6addrctl # KEYWORD: shutdown # # # Start or stop the IPv6 tunnel to Freenet6.net # # Add the following lines to /etc/rc.conf to enable freenet6: # # freenet6_enable="YES" # freenet6_flags="-f %%PREFIX%%/etc/gw6c.conf" # . /etc/rc.subr name=freenet6 rcvar=freenet6_enable +sig_stop="HUP" command=%%PREFIX%%/bin/gw6c required_files=%%PREFIX%%/etc/freenet6/gw6c.conf # set defaults freenet6_enable=${freenet6_enable:-"NO"} freenet6_flags=${freenet6_flags:-"-f %%PREFIX%%/etc/freenet6/gw6c.conf"} load_rc_config $name run_rc_command "$1" Index: head/net/freenet6/files/patch-src_net_icmp__echo__engine.c =================================================================== --- head/net/freenet6/files/patch-src_net_icmp__echo__engine.c (nonexistent) +++ head/net/freenet6/files/patch-src_net_icmp__echo__engine.c (revision 443692) @@ -0,0 +1,11 @@ +--- src/net/icmp_echo_engine.c.orig 2017-06-16 09:08:10 UTC ++++ src/net/icmp_echo_engine.c +@@ -238,7 +238,7 @@ iee_ret_t IEE_init( void** pp_config, iee_mode_t eng_m + p_engine->clbk_recv = recv_clbk; + + // Initialize engine socket variables. +- p_engine->icmp_echo_id = pal_getpid(); ++ p_engine->icmp_echo_id = pal_getpid() % 65536; + p_engine->icmp_saf = af; + switch( p_engine->icmp_saf ) + { Property changes on: head/net/freenet6/files/patch-src_net_icmp__echo__engine.c ___________________________________________________________________ Added: fbsd:nokeywords ## -0,0 +1 ## +yes \ No newline at end of property Added: svn:eol-style ## -0,0 +1 ## +native \ No newline at end of property Added: svn:mime-type ## -0,0 +1 ## +text/plain \ No newline at end of property Index: head/net/freenet6/files/patch-template_freebsd.sh =================================================================== --- head/net/freenet6/files/patch-template_freebsd.sh (nonexistent) +++ head/net/freenet6/files/patch-template_freebsd.sh (revision 443692) @@ -0,0 +1,11 @@ +--- template/freebsd.sh.orig 2017-06-16 09:11:57 UTC ++++ template/freebsd.sh +@@ -201,7 +201,7 @@ if [ X"${TSP_TUNNEL_MODE}" = X"v6v4" ] || [ X"${TSP_TU + fi + # + # Configured tunnel config (IPv6) +- ++ Exec $ifconfig $TSP_TUNNEL_INTERFACE inet6 -ifdisabled + Exec $ifconfig $TSP_TUNNEL_INTERFACE inet6 $TSP_CLIENT_ADDRESS_IPV6 $TSP_SERVER_ADDRESS_IPV6 prefixlen $TSP_TUNNEL_PREFIXLEN alias + Exec $ifconfig $TSP_TUNNEL_INTERFACE mtu 1280 + # Property changes on: head/net/freenet6/files/patch-template_freebsd.sh ___________________________________________________________________ Added: fbsd:nokeywords ## -0,0 +1 ## +yes \ No newline at end of property Added: svn:eol-style ## -0,0 +1 ## +native \ No newline at end of property Added: svn:mime-type ## -0,0 +1 ## +text/plain \ No newline at end of property